Dean,
Neat cap! Interestingly, the visor is a surplus A-1 - with the same drawing number as the add-on bill with snaps. The construction appears identical to the one I have.
So someone was making these using the bills.
Besides the drawing number, you can tell the bill is of a different material than the body of the cap. I can even see the stitched bar tack peeking out from the body in the second pic - also present at the base of the A-1 visor.
